About this service
Increase Authorized Share Capital of a Company is a key regulatory filing administered by Ministry of Corporate Affairs (MCA) โ Registrar of Companies (RoC) of the State where the registered office is situated.. Filing is executed via **SH-7** โ Notice of consolidation / division / increase in share capital under s.64 (filed within 30 days of alteration of MoA); **PAS-3** โ Return of allotment under s.39(4) read with Rule 12 of Companies (Prospectus and Allotment of Securities) Rules 2014 (filed within 30 days of allotment of shares); **MGT-14** โ Filing of Special Resolution for alteration of MoA under s.13 (within 30 days of resolution). under Companies Act, 2013 โ Sections 13 (alteration of MoA โ for change in authorised capital clause โ proviso to s.13(1)), 61 (alteration of share capital โ sub-section (1)(b) for increase in authorised capital), 62 (further issue of capital โ for actual issuance of new shares beyond authorised capital), 64 (notice to be given to RoC for alteration of share capital โ Form SH-7 within 30 days); Companies (Prospectus and Allotment of Securities) Rules, 2014 (Rule 12 โ Form PAS-3 for allotment of shares within 30 days of allotment); Companies (Share Capital and Debentures) Rules, 2014 (Rule 15 โ filing of SH-7); Companies (Registration Offices and Fees) Rules 2014 (Annexure I โ fee schedule based on increase in authorised capital)..
